Plaza Home Mortgage has announced its sixth annual donation program to support
Susan G. Komen San Diego. For the month of October, Breast Cancer Awareness Month, Plaza will make a donation to Komen San Diego based on its total month-end loan volume.
For the past six years, Plaza has contributed more than $450,000 to Komen San Diego. Plaza’s contributions have helped thousands of women get free mammograms, biopsies, ultrasounds, care coordination, education and financial assistance for breast cancer patients’ most critical needs during treatment. This year, Plaza’s support will be designated to helping women and their families who need assistance covering living expenses, like rent or a mortgage, while they are going through treatment.
